Just two short, constructive note
Set the (lower) altimeter to QNH zero next time. The best one, if you know it the own one (AFB ground level, QFE altitude) and the altitude of the target (now sea level), you can calculate the difference then. In the video your altimeter showed 80m height from runaway, the airport's altitude above a sea is added to this (~40-50 m). Bacause of this, the automatics throws the bombs from ~30-40m* higher, what the set on the upper altimeter is. Of course, its much more important between mountains, than on the seacoast

The bombers engine management demands bigger attention, than the fighters - in the game sure. Let the Stuka not exceed these values flying until long time: 2100 rpm, 1.1 ata (manual p. 94). When necessary, may push full power, but not exceed this at the time of long, calm flyings. And the aircraft will not shake then on a return flying.
